Yes, weight gain is a known side effect of birth control pills. You can mention to your doctor that you are gaining weight after you started taking the pill - maybe he can switch you to a different birth control brand with lower hormone dose.
Walking 4 miles a day is very very good - most people don't walk nearly as much... The majority of people just walk across the parking lot to get to their car - and that's all walking they do for the day :-)
You can try doing aerobics several times a week - this burns a lot of calories. See if you can join aerobics class, or get a video and try to follow it by yourself.
Also, one easy way to cut some calories without feeling hungry is to drink water instead of soft drinks. A can of soda has about 150 calories, and water 0 calories... so if you drink water instead of 2 cans of soda a day, you'll save 300 calories!
Also, try to avoid restaurants. Prepare your meals at home, so you can control what goes in there... Avoid junk foods and high fat foods. Do not fry your food in oil - try to use baking, steaming and boiling as your main cooking methods. Eat smaller portions.
If you incorporate even some of these changes into your lifestyle, you can definately lose those 10 pounds. Just remember that weight loss is a gradual process, and you need to be persistent and don't get discouraged if you don't start losing weight right away.

Weight loss pills and stuff like Herbalife do not work for permanent loss of FAT (some can create an illusion of weight loss, but the person is losing just water, not fat) and can be dangerous to your health. The only way to lose weight safely and permanently is by following a healthy diet and increasing the activity level.
All those manufacturers of diet drugs/pills/shakes/supplements are making tons of money by making false promises of "easy weight loss", and playing on the emotions of people who are desperate to lose weight.
If something is classified as a "herb" and not a "drug", it does not mean it is safe. "Herbs" are not regulated by the FDA as tightely as substances classified as drugs, but those herbs cause bad side effects in many people - there were even incindents of people dying from them.
